Transaction 76991958ffe5c5120ab651893cf3a4303292d7258b82bfeec74a8321d5e2d513

1 Input
2 Outputs
  • 76991958ffe5c5120ab651893cf3a4303292d7258b82bfeec74a8321d5e2d513:0
  • value  1493545
    address  31vxGSWLKHbLus6kcU7XBFvGQGtJT1KdHZ
  • 76991958ffe5c5120ab651893cf3a4303292d7258b82bfeec74a8321d5e2d513:1
  • value  247364144
    address  3AmuPL37fQMfd4wofRZar7YAHe89Z5ue5k